Frequently Asked Questions

Is West Lynn a good place to live?
West Lynn is a good place to live. West Lynn is considered fairly walkable and bikeable with good transit options. West Lynn has 4 parks for recreational activities. It has a median age of 33. The average household income is $83,447 which is below the national average. College graduates make up 9% of residents. A majority of residents in West Lynn are renters, with 62.3% of residents renting and 37.7% of residents owning their home. How much do you need to make to afford a house in West Lynn?
The median home price in West Lynn is $600,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$120,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.72%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$3,100 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$133K a year to afford the median home price in West Lynn. The average household income in West Lynn is $83K.
